It was clear and windy yesterday, and the temperate went from about 65 to 75 over the course of the morning. There were two full relays with a number of Hunter class pistols.

I was one of three B shooters and shot a 23/60 (6 better than last month, and my first A score :) ).

I was shooting with my Henry H001T fitted with a new Pedersoli USA-433 creedmore sight.

IMHO, if you're going to use a tang sight, a creedmore-style sight is better for silhouette than a Marbles tang sight because you don't have to rely on counting clicks. The creedmore sight I selected is inexpensive ($60), but has a non-repeatable windage adjustment, and is almost too tall for the gun. I'm considering getting the USA-461 because it has a better elevation vernier as well as a vernier for windage, and is a little shorter than the one I currently have. The only problem is that it's kinda pricey at $200.
